Experience the charm of Stoneleigh Barn Bed and Breakfast, a cozy 3-star establishment located in North Wootton, just 1.7mi from the city center of Sherborne, United Kingdom. With 323 rave reviews, this bed and breakfast is renowned for its hospitality and comfortable accommodations.
The Stoneleigh Barn offers a range of amenities to ensure a pleasant stay, including free private parking, WiFi, soundproof and non-smoking rooms, and even beach umbrellas for a day of relaxation. Guests can also enjoy the beautiful garden, sun deck, terrace, and picnic area, perfect for unwinding after a day of exploring the picturesque surroundings.

The property was amazing. I was greeted by Rupert who helped with my luggage. He kindly offered me a drink and I was able to sit in the lovely garden having a pot of tea. I was in the Blue Room which was lovely. Very spacious and light. The bathroom was large with a roll top bath and a wet room shower. The room had everything you needed including a full size kettle/iron/ironing board/hairdryer. Breakfast was lovely and I enjoyed sitting in the conservatory looking out at the garden. Rupert was a really nice host and I was very pleased that I had booked this accommodation as part of my stay in the Dorset area. His dog Nutmeg was very sweet!

Attractive building with large rooms (we had the Blue Room) and set into the hillside with large rear garden where we sat in a thatched circular seated arbour drinking our welcome coffee listening to the bird’s singing in the surrounding trees. A lovely way to relax after a long journey. Rupert was a charming host who gave us a warm welcome and offered to bring our drinks into the garden where we also had the picnic we had brought with us, which we ate in the light of the setting sun. Rupert also cooked excellent breakfasts! We would recommend this to others and will be back.
